Building Robust and Scalable Back-End Systems

Constructing reliable and extensible back-end systems is paramount for modern web applications. These systems serve as the backbone upon which user interfaces and business logic operate. A robust back-end should be capable check here of managing large volumes of data, providing high availability, and scaling to meet fluctuating demands. Utilizing best practices in software development, such as modular design, consistency, and comprehensive testing, is crucial for building durable back-end systems.

To achieve scalability, consider distributed architectures, containerization technologies, and cloud computing platforms. These methods allow for horizontal scaling, increasing the system's capacity by adding more servers. Moreover, implementing caching mechanisms, optimizing database performance, and leveraging content delivery networks (CDNs) can significantly accelerate application responsiveness.

Enhance Website Performance for Speed and SEO

In today's digital landscape, website speed and search engine optimization (SEO) are paramount for success. A fast website not only provides a seamless user experience but also appears prominently in search engine results pages (SERPs). To achieve optimal performance, websites should be optimized for speed and SEO. This involves adopting various strategies such as reducing image sizes, storing website content, and using a content delivery network (CDN).

Additionally, SEO best practices such as analyzing search trends, improving website content, and acquiring backlinks are crucial for boosting search engine rankings. By focusing on both speed and SEO, websites can increase traffic, ultimately achieving success.
